Whispers of the Ancient Tai Chi: The Dragon's Awakening

The sun dipped below the horizon, casting long shadows across the serene Tai Chi Garden. In the heart of this tranquil haven, a young woman named Ying, with a silhouette as graceful as the willow swaying in the gentle breeze, practiced the ancient art with fervent dedication. She had spent years in seclusion, mastering the intricate movements that required balance, patience, and a deep connection to her inner self.

Ying was the last heir of the Dragon Dynasty, a lineage that had been hidden for centuries, its existence shrouded in mystery. Her father, the last Dragon Master, had vanished without a trace, leaving behind only cryptic messages and a promise of a great power hidden within the ancient Tai Chi techniques. As the Dragon's descendant, Ying felt an unspoken bond to the mythical creature that had given her people their name and purpose.

One evening, as the moon began to rise, Ying felt a sudden surge of energy within her. It was a sign, she was certain, that her journey was about to take a dramatic turn. She closed her eyes, focusing her chi, the life force that flows through all living things, and visualized the dragon that had been her ancestor's guardian.

Suddenly, the ground beneath her trembled, and the ancient stones of the garden seemed to pulse with a life of their own. With a gasp, Ying opened her eyes to find the garden transformed. The shadows danced with the outline of a majestic dragon, its scales shimmering with an otherworldly light. The dragon's eyes met hers, and in that moment, Ying knew her destiny was no longer hers alone.

"Ying, you must awaken the Dragon's spirit within you," a voice echoed through the garden. She turned to see an old man, his hair as white as the moon, standing at the edge of the garden. "The time has come for you to embrace your legacy and face the darkness that seeks to destroy the Dragon Dynasty."

The old man was a mentor to Ying's father, a guardian of the ancient Tai Chi techniques. He had been watching over her, guiding her through her training, but now it was time for Ying to step into the role she was born for.

"I will not fail," Ying declared, her voice filled with resolve. "I will protect the legacy of the Dragon Dynasty and ensure that the balance of power in this world is maintained."

The old man nodded, his eyes filled with a mixture of pride and worry. "But be warned, Ying, the path you must walk is fraught with peril. The Dragon's spirit is not easily awakened, and those who seek to control it will stop at nothing to obtain its power."

As the old man disappeared into the shadows, Ying knew that she had to move quickly. She returned to her quarters, where the ancient scrolls and artifacts of her lineage awaited her. She began the arduous task of deciphering the cryptic messages, searching for the key to awakening the Dragon's spirit.

Days turned into weeks, and Ying's determination grew. She found herself drawn to a particular scroll, one that spoke of a ritual that could unleash the Dragon's power. But the ritual was dangerous, and it required a sacrifice. Ying knew that the sacrifice would be herself, her life force being the fuel to awaken the Dragon's spirit.

As the final night of her training approached, Ying stood before the altar, her heart pounding with a mix of fear and anticipation. She took a deep breath, closed her eyes, and began the ritual. The ancient symbols glowed, and the air around her crackled with energy. Suddenly, the room was filled with a blinding light, and Ying felt herself being pulled into a vortex of power.

When the light faded, Ying opened her eyes to find herself in a realm of fire and ice, the essence of the Dragon's spirit manifesting before her. The dragon, with scales of sapphire and eyes of molten gold, roared, its voice echoing through the void. "You have done well, descendant of the Dragon Dynasty. Now, you must choose your path."

Ying stepped forward, her heart pounding with courage. "I will fight for the good of all, and I will not bend to the darkness that seeks to control our world."

The dragon nodded, its form dissipating into a shower of light. Ying felt the power of the Dragon's spirit envelop her, and she knew that her destiny was no longer a secret. She was the Dragon's descendant, and she would be the one to protect the legacy of the Dragon Dynasty.

As the dawn broke, Ying returned to the garden, her heart filled with a newfound sense of purpose. She had faced the darkness within her and emerged stronger. The path ahead was fraught with challenges, but Ying was ready to face them, for she was no longer alone. The Dragon's spirit lived within her, and together, they would ensure that the legacy of the Dragon Dynasty would never fade.

With the rise of the sun, Ying began her journey, the Dragon's spirit a silent guardian at her side. The world of martial arts would never be the same, for the Dragon's descendant had awakened, and her legacy was about to change the course of history.
